La Plagne, with its strong SnowSure score of 59, impresses with an impressive snow base of 158cm, ensuring excellent skiing conditions. La Rosière claims the top spot with a SnowSure score of 60, boasting a snow base of 144cm and a promising 14-day forecast of 126cm, making it a must-visit for snow enthusiasts. Meanwhile, Alpe d'Huez and Avoriaz in France, along with Courmayeur in Italy, also stand out with excellent SnowSure scores and promising snow bases. These conditions not only enhance the quality of the terrain but also offer diverse skiing experiences across the continent, ensuring something for every skier.

In the past 24 hours, La Rosière, Avoriaz, and Courmayeur received 9cm of fresh snow, providing ideal conditions for powder skiing today. Alpe d'Huez and Megève follow closely with 8cm each, promising a fresh blanket of snow for eager skiers. This recent snowfall, combined with favorable weather conditions, ensures that these resorts offer some of the best powder skiing experiences in Europe today.

Looking ahead, Courmayeur in Italy boasts the most promising 14-day outlook with 139cm of expected snow, followed closely by La Plagne and Alpe d'Huez with 128cm each. Significant snowfall is anticipated in the upcoming weeks, particularly around the weekend, making it an excellent time to plan your skiing adventures.
